In order to complete the high level vibration test of pipeline in spacecraftheoretical analysis results show that the decisive factor for the pipeline failure is vibration strain, cutting the high frequency region of vibration environment can significantly reduce the vibration magnitudethe difference of the pipeline vibration strain before and after cutting high frequency region respectively by test and finite element method. The results show that under the principle the cut?off frequency higher than the main resonance frequency, the cut?off frequency is chosen to reduce the vibration magnitude, and the vibration strains of the pipeline are not affected. It is acceptable that cutting off the vibration test condition to replace the original vibration test condition the feasibility of pipeline vibration test.
